FYI, Wiggins was a 2nd rounder. He would've gone 1st round, except he was coming off TJ surgery. This is his first full season back. He's in A+ ball. 1.71 ERA. 26 innings 31 SO's and only 13 hits allowed. His BTV is 2.8. Need I say more?
